However, As I understand this is not a good solution, we cannot keep on stopping our fluentd every … WebOpen OpenSearch Dashboards from the OpenSearch Service console. 2. Choose the Index Management tab. 3. Select the index that you want to attach your ISM policy to (for example: "test-index-000001"). 4. Choose Apply policy. 5. (Optional) If your policy specifies any actions that require an alias, provide the alias, and then choose Apply.
Policies OpenSearch documentation Index State Management Policies Policies Policies are JSON documents that define the following: The states that an index can be in, including the default state for new indexes. For example, you might name your states “hot,” “warm,” “delete,” and so on. For more … Ver mais A state is the description of the status that the managed index is currently in. A managed index can be in only one state at a time. Each state has associated actions that are executed sequentially on entering a state and transitions … Ver mais Transitions define the conditions that need to be met for a state to change. After all actions in the current state are completed, the policy starts checking the conditions for transitions. ISM … Ver mais Actions are the steps that the policy sequentially executes on entering a specific state. ISM executes actions in the order in which they are defined.
